Abstract
A folder is described which holds and protects media, such as multiple disks, during and subsequent to shipping. An insert is provided that may be assembled with the folder and which increases the disk storage capacity of the folder assembly. A pocket is also provided to hold documentation associated with the disks.

Description
FIELD OF THE INVENTION

This invention relates to a folder for holding and protecting media, such as computer disks and the like.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

Computer software, including various types of digitally encoded information used with computers, is often bought and sold. To transfer this software to the customer, the seller typically stores the software on a media, such as compact discs or floppy disks. This media must then be packaged for sale and shipment. The software product may also include periodic updates, requiring that updates be shipped to each customer several times per year. In addition to the significant number of shipments that may be required, there is also variation among different software products and their updates. While some shipments may include only one disk, others, containing multiple or complex products, may require several disks. As existing products are enhanced, and future products are produced, an increasing number of disks are often required.
